River Overlook right outside Glacier National Park
Enjoy this freshly remodeled 4 bed, 2 bath home on an acre located above the Flathead River with beautiful views in all directions! Central AC added in June 2021. Located just 10 minutes from the west entrance of Glacier National Park this is the perfect home base for hiking, fishing, biking, floating the river, driving Going-to-the-Sun Highway, boating and winter recreation! The property is located a few blocks from a grocery store and various other shops you may want to visit. Regarding the bedrooms, you do pass through the queen bedroom on the main floor to access the bunk bed room. There are several steps up to the other 2 queen bedrooms with a bathroom with walk-in shower between them. The other full bathroom is on the main floor. The home has brand new furniture and furnishings in 2020 and is ready to welcome your group for a trip to remember to the Flathead!! The property sits above the Flathead River, as shown in the photos, and there is a very steep bank to the river which prohibits walking directly to it. There are, however, several river access points very nearby! We have cornhole for the back yard, and ping pong table and wall darts downstairs! This home is dog-friendly up to 2 dogs as long as you notify the host at the time of booking and clean up after them. No cats allowed, thank you. Contact me for extended stay discounts. The property sits above the Flathead River and has amazing views but also a very steep bank down to the river and therefore cannot be accessed from the property. There are several river access points very nearby and the river is wonderful for floating or fly fishing (get a local fishing license at Sportsmans or Snappy Sporting Goods)!
Located just:
1 mile from river access into South Fork Flathead River.
4 miles from Hungry Horse Dam and Hungry Horse Reservoir.
39 miles from Lakeside, on of the many towns that surround Flathead Lake, which will have everything you may need for your stay. Including, groceries, shopping, eating, and entertainment.
14 miles from Glacier Park Airport.
23 miles from Kalispell, a great place to hit Costco, Target, or any other big store before your stay.
16 miles from Whitefish, with fun shopping, restaurants, and activities. As well as skiing at Whitefish Mountain Resort and swimming at Whitefish City Beach.
10 miles from West Glacier at Glacier National Park.
